I have not yet tried to slipstream the below listed hotfixes, but intend to have a go soon. Has anyone else? I hope to be able to include them in the Updates page (and also perhaps WildBill's unofficial updates, but this post doesn't address them).

The hotfixes below for Windows 2000 SP4 (Pro and/or Server) contain files which seem to be newer than those available from the updates on the Windows 2000 Updates page I maintain. These hotfixes were issued to address specific issues, and were not included in SP4 or the later SP4 Update Rollup 1. Many of the KB articles for these hotfixes mention 'SP5'. Probably several (if not all) of these 'new' files were included in MSFN member Gurglemeyer's Unofficial SP5 project. Most of these are available upon request from Microsoft.

Mmmhhhh...

Perhaps you meant "831375"?

Indeed I did. Thanks for pointing out my error. I've updated the list.

Actually, the note is possibly redundant in the context of HFSLIP. At least, I can just say that I found that manually installing 873437 before 831375 gave my system some kind of general protection error (if I recall correctly), and the OS wouldn't finish the boot process.

Another question about KB838417: the italian page suggest two fixes, one labeled as `sp5' and another as `latest'! Which one is needed?

Here's the link, thank you.

I'll have to get back to you on that. I suspect one of those files is just some sort of registry fix, but don't quote me. Meanwhile, if you've requested and downloaded both, you could try running a Command Prompt from the folder in which you saved the two updates, with the "-x" parameter, which will extract the contents of those files, so that you can compare their respective contents for date and build number. So for example, you would use a command like this:


Windows2000-KB838417-x86-ENU.EXE -x

"Windows2000-KB838417-x86-ENU.EXE" being the update's filename in this case.

@Bristols:

about your windows2000 updates page, I just slipstreamed Q828026 and I can confirm it is unneeded. As reported here, on windows 2000 it provides

  • msdxm.ocx ver 6.4.9.1128
  • wmp.dll ver 9.0.0.3075

Well, msdxm.ocx is updated by KB891861 which provides ver 6.4.9.1129, and wmp.dll is updated by KB979402 which provides version 9.0.0.3367.
